Subdivision

Besides Nordstemmen proper, the municipality consists of the villages of Adensen, Barnten, Burgstemmen, Groß Escherde, Hallerburg, Heyersum, Klein Escherde, Mahlerten and Rössing.


Mayor

The mayor is Nicole Dombrowski (independent), she was elected in September 2020.
